About the role
We are seeking an experienced R&D Systems Engineer to join our organization. In this role, you will provide engineering and defect prevention expertise to MESA's high-reliability microelectronics programs, including Application Specific Integrated Circuits, Heterojunction Bipolar Transistors, and Electrical Environmental Sensing Devices.
Responsibilities
- Provide engineering and defect prevention expertise to product realization teams and manufacturing process areas such as wafer fabrication, packaging, electrical test, burn-in, and product delivery for high-reliability microelectronic products.
- Engage in projects spanning all phases of the product realization lifecycle from conceptual design and development through production, maintenance, and retirement.
- Lead anomaly resolution and structured problem-solving teams through root cause analysis, identifying potential solutions, and evaluating their effectiveness.
- Implement process improvements to reduce defects while maintaining or enhancing performance parameters.
- Champion quality and continuous improvement initiatives.
- Participate in audits and assessments (e.g., ISO 9001, NNSA Quality Assurance Surveys, DMEA, RPSS).
- Occasional travel as required.
